My Pose Method of running journey began in mid-April of 2005. After 14 years of competing at the Highschool, Collegiate, and Post-collegiate level I had decided to begin my efforts towards coaching and training others. As I began my coaching career at a Division III College in Louisiana I quickly realized that in order to help my beginning runners improve with as little risk of injury and with the fastest improvements in their performances I would need to continue to find a specific model of running technique that I could teach and evaluate them under.
My search ultimately led me to the "Pose Method of running". Though there is lots of data out there about running, there seem to be very little agreement on how to teach running as a skill. As I examined and evaluated the technique I quickly realized both from a common sense approach as well as from a scientific standpoint how and why the Pose Method model of running would not only help my runners, but also give any runner the capability to run faster, and injury free.
